Re-purposed beer box
4 Attachment(s)
I wanted to make my shelving unit look neater with storage boxes.So I just covered a few beer boxes(had great fun emptying the boxes)lol!
Pic 1; I cut 4cm off the top and used masking tape to hold the flaps together for the height that I wanted.I also made a frame of masking tape around the edge of the box and painted it white because I was using a 12"x12" page and it didn't cover all the way to the edges. Pic 2; I stuck some double sided tape on the back of the paper. Pic 3; I stuck the page to the front of the box. Pic 4; They look neater in my unit. I want to make a couple more and if I get a chance I'l cover the sides as well. Thanks for looking Regards Scrabble |
